PHILIPPI — A pair of opposing seniors put the first two goals of the evening in the net Wednesday at BC Bank Park as the visiting Lady Buccaneers of B-UHS took on the Philip Barbour Colts in a tune-up scrimmage game.

Senior Molly Clark took care of a blocked shot from the left side for PBH and put it away for a 1-0 Lady Colts lead.

Buckhannon-Upshur 12th-grader Lauren Bennett worked her way past the 18-yard mark at the top of the goalie’s box and delivered a right-footed blast to tie the contest tied at 1-1. Buckhannon tacked on one more in the second half to get the preliminary slate victory.

“We’ve looked pretty good and haven’t been behind until tonight,” PBHS coach Pete Ferguson said. “I think the summer sessions are doing us a lot of good with a young squad returning.”

Buckhannon’s veteran coach Julie Zuliani said, “We have a large freshman class. When we figure out where they fit best in our system with our upperclassmen, we could have a really good season.

“We are pleased with tonight’s effort, and excited for the upcoming season to start.”

Zuliani also noted a PBHS player was injured during the scrimmage and showed genuine concern.

“I hope the PB player is OK. It’s always upsetting to see a player sidelined with an injury,” she said
